Add USB Controller Auto-Detection and Configuration #7

Description

Different boards use different USB controllers (dwc2, dwc3, tegra-xudc). The gadget should auto-detect and configure appropriately.

Current Problem

The current implementation assumes dwc2 controller and doesn't adapt to different hardware platforms.

Implementation

Detect USB controller type and configure:

  • USB version (2.0 vs 3.0)
  • Power settings (bus-powered vs self-powered)
  • Device class and attributes

Detection Logic

# Check for dwc3 (USB 3.x)
if lsmod | grep -q "dwc3" || find /sys/class/udc -name "*dwc3*"; then
    USB_VERSION="0x0300"  # USB 3.0
    USB_CONTROLLER="dwc3"
# Check for dwc2 (USB 2.0)
elif lsmod | grep -q "dwc2" || find /sys/class/udc -name "*dwc2*"; then
    USB_VERSION="0x0200"  # USB 2.0
    USB_CONTROLLER="dwc2"
# Check for Tegra (Jetson)
elif lsmod | grep -q "tegra_xudc" || find /sys/class/udc -name "*tegra*"; then
    USB_VERSION="0x0300"  # USB 3.0
    USB_CONTROLLER="tegra-xudc"
fi

Power Configuration

if [ "$USB_CONTROLLER" = "dwc3" ]; then
    # Self-powered device
    echo 0xC0 > configs/c.1/bmAttributes
else
    # Bus-powered device
    echo 0x80 > configs/c.1/bmAttributes
    echo 250 > configs/c.1/MaxPower
fi

Acceptance Criteria

  • Correctly identifies dwc2, dwc3, tegra-xudc controllers
  • Sets USB version based on controller capabilities
  • Configures power settings appropriately
  • Works across RPi, Jetson, and generic ARM platforms
  • Logs detected controller for debugging
  • Handles unknown controllers gracefully
